Problem

Current technologies lack effective solutions for promoting desirable social and emotional growth in users, particularly children, by addressing behavioral and sociological issues such as bullying, peer pressure, and academic underachievement through adaptive and interactive behavior modification software.

Innovation Solution

The development of an adaptive behavior modification software system that presents users with scenarios and questions, allowing them to choose answers associated with behavioral scores, which adjust their profiles and determine subsequent paths within the program, thereby guiding them through self-paced, web-based modules focused on positive social behavior and decision-making skills.

AI summary

A method for operating a behavior modification software comprises identifying a user profile comprising a behavioral score; presenting an illustration associated with a scenario, the scenario associated with at least one question, each question associated with at least two answers, wherein each answer is associated with a behavior score modifier; receiving selection of a selected question within the scenario; presenting the selected question to a user in response to the selection and at least a subset of the answers associated with the selected question; receiving a selected answer from the user in response to presenting the question; evaluating input from the user based on the behavior score modifier associated with the received selected answer; adjusting the behavioral score based on the behavior score modifier; and determining a path based on the user's adjusted behavioral score, wherein the path identifies a next operation within the behavioral modification software.
